Difference Between Flammable And Combustible

When talking about fire safety, many people use the words flammable and combustible without realizing they refer to two different categories of materials. Although both terms deal with how easily a substance can burn, the difference between flammable and combustible materials is important in workplaces, homes, and industrial settings. Understanding these classifications helps prevent accidents, improves storage practices, and supports better safety planning. By exploring how these terms are defined and how they apply to everyday items, it becomes easier to recognize potential fire risks and respond to them responsibly.

Understanding Flammable Materials

Flammable materials are substances that ignite easily and burn rapidly at relatively low temperatures. These materials have a low flash point, which is the minimum temperature at which a substance releases enough vapor to catch fire in the presence of an ignition source.

Flash Point of Flammable Materials

Flammable liquids have a flash point below 100°F (37.8°C). This means they can ignite even at normal room temperature if exposed to a flame, spark, or sufficient heat. Because of this, they require careful handling and storage.

  • Flash point below 100°F

  • Ignites easily at low temperatures

  • Requires controlled storage and ventilation

Common Examples of Flammable Materials

Many everyday household items fall into the flammable category. These materials are particularly risky when stored incorrectly or used near open flames.

  • Gasoline

  • Acetone (nail polish remover)

  • Alcohol-based cleaners

  • Propane

  • Paint thinners

Where Flammable Materials Are Commonly Found

These materials are not limited to industrial sites. They are often used in homes, garages, and workplaces. Recognizing their presence helps reduce the chance of accidental ignition.

Understanding Combustible Materials

Combustible materials also burn, but they require higher temperatures to ignite. They have a higher flash point than flammable materials, meaning they are less likely to catch fire at room temperature.

Flash Point of Combustible Materials

Combustible liquids typically have a flash point above 100°F (37.8°C). Because they need more heat to produce ignitable vapors, they are considered somewhat safer than flammable liquids. However, they still pose a fire risk under certain conditions.

  • Flash point over 100°F

  • Requires higher heat to ignite

  • Still dangerous under high-temperature conditions

Examples of Combustible Materials

Combustible materials are found in many industries, including construction, manufacturing, and transportation.

  • Diesel fuel

  • Motor oil

  • Wood

  • Charcoal

  • Heavy lubricants

How Combustible Materials Behave

Although they do not ignite as easily as flammable materials, combustibles can burn fiercely once they reach the proper temperature. Improper storage or exposure to high heat increases fire risk significantly.

Key Differences Between Flammable and Combustible Materials

Understanding the difference between flammable and combustible materials comes down to ignition temperature, storage requirements, and typical use. These categories help manufacturers, safety professionals, and consumers determine the proper handling procedures.

Difference in Flash Point

The flash point is the most important distinction between the two.

  • FlammableIgnites below 100°F

  • CombustibleIgnites above 100°F

This temperature difference is why flammable materials are considered more hazardous in everyday environments.

Difference in Storage Requirements

Flammable materials often require special containers, ventilation, and temperature control. Combustible materials may have fewer restrictions, but they still need proper labeling and secure storage to prevent accidents.

  • Flammable materials often stored in approved safety cabinets.

  • Combustible materials may be stored at room temperature with basic precautions.

Difference in Risk Level

While both categories present fire hazards, flammable materials are generally considered the more dangerous due to their ability to ignite so easily.

  • Flammable liquids pose immediate risk if spilled or exposed to sparks.

  • Combustibles require more intense heat but can still contribute to large fires.

Difference in Regulatory Classification

Fire codes, transportation rules, and workplace safety guidelines classify materials partly based on whether they are flammable or combustible. This helps ensure proper labeling and emergency preparedness.

How to Identify Whether a Material Is Flammable or Combustible

People often rely on labeling and product data to determine fire risk. Many containers display safety symbols or warnings that indicate whether the contents are flammable or combustible.

Check the Safety Data Sheet (SDS)

The SDS provides exact flash point information, handling guidelines, and emergency procedures. This is the most reliable method for identifying risk levels.

Read Product Labels

Most consumer products clearly state if they are flammable. Fuel containers, cleaners, and aerosols often warn users to keep away from heat and sparks.

Observe Storage Instructions

Manufacturers provide recommended storage conditions based on risk level. Flammable items usually have stricter instructions than combustibles.

Why the Difference Matters

Knowing the difference between flammable and combustible materials can prevent dangerous situations. Many accidents occur simply because people do not realize how easily certain everyday liquids can ignite.

Fire Prevention

Correctly handling these materials reduces the likelihood of ignition. Simple actions such as sealing containers, avoiding smoking near volatile liquids, and ensuring good ventilation can make a significant difference.

Emergency Preparedness

Understanding the fire risk category helps people choose the right extinguishers, safety equipment, and response strategies in case of an emergency.

Legal and Workplace Compliance

Businesses are required to follow safety standards that classify materials by flash point. Proper storage, employee training, and hazard communication depend heavily on understanding these differences.

Real-Life Examples of Fire Risk

Everyday scenarios show how important these distinctions are. For instance, gasoline spilled in a garage can ignite from a tiny spark because it is highly flammable. On the other hand, a container of motor oil left near a heat source might not ignite immediately, but if heated long enough, it can still burn intensely as a combustible material.

Common Situations Involving Flammable Materials

  • Using aerosol sprays near stovetops

  • Storing gasoline in unapproved containers

  • Spills near electrical equipment

Common Situations Involving Combustible Materials

  • Rags soaked in oil left in hot environments

  • Wood stored too close to furnaces

  • Overheated machinery near lubricants

Understanding the difference between flammable and combustible materials is essential for fire safety in homes, workplaces, and industrial environments. Flammable materials ignite easily at low temperatures, while combustible materials require more heat to catch fire. Recognizing flash points, reading labels, and following proper storage guidelines helps reduce risk and ensures safer conditions for everyone. By paying attention to these distinctions, individuals and organizations can better manage hazards and prevent accidents involving fire and heat.
